Berlin Weather During the Event

In September, the weather in Berlin is typically changeable. Temperatures usually range between 10°C and 19°C.

Before heading out, check the Berlin hourly weather.

Clothing Tip: Layered clothing: T-shirt, sweater, and a light jacket.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q What is the best type of tour in Berlin?

Guided historical tours—especially those focusing on WWII and the Cold War—provide the most value. Walking tours in the Mitte district are highly recommended for first-time visitors.

Q Do I need to book Berlin tours in advance?

Yes. Premium small-group tours often sell out 3-4 days in advance during the summer season (May to September). Booking online ensures your spot and usually includes skip-the-line access.

Q Are there free tours in Berlin?

Yes, many 'free' tours exist near the Brandenburg Gate. However, keep in mind that guides rely entirely on tips, and group sizes can often exceed 40 people, making for a less personal experience.
